Andretti Racing (also known as Mario Andretti Racing) is a video game that was released in 1994 on the Sega Mega Drive and Genesis. It was an early title in the newlycreated EA Sports line, and was developed by Stormfront Studios. The game was produced by famed sports game developer Scott Orr as part of his collaboration with Richard Hilleman in the creation of EA Sports. Race driver Mario Andretti personally guided the development of the AI used by the nonplayer drivers in stock cars, Indy style open wheel racing, and dirt track racing. Battle Cars is a video game for the Super NES published by Namco in 1993. It is a futuristic racing game in which cars are equipped with missiles, grenade launchers, and sliding disks which are used to eliminate opponents. The game can be played by either one or two players. In a oneplayer game, the player progresses through a series of progressively harder levels. Two players can alternate as each progresses through the levels of the oneplayer game, or they may go headtohead in a number of race tracks. Daytona USA is a racing arcade game by Sega and the highest grossing arcade machine of all time . Daytona USA was Segas first title to debut on the Sega Model 2 arcade board, and at the time of its 1993 introduction, was considered the most visually detailed 3D arcade racing game. Despite a lower polygoncount than its predecessor, Virtua Racing, Daytonas 3Dworld was fully texturemapped, giving it a more realistic appearance than the former. Daytona was one of the first video games to feature filtered, texturemapped polygons, giving it the most detailed graphics yet seen in a video game up until that time. In singleplayer mode, Daytona maintained a consistent 60fps refresh rate, even with multiple opponents on screen, surpassing the motion smoothness of the only other racing game in a comparable graphical arena, Namcos Ridge Racer. GeneRally is a freeware racing game originally developed by brothers Hannu and Jukka R bin from Finland. Although it features a 3D graphics engine, GeneRally has a topdown perspective, where you can see all the cars (which is perfect for multiplayer races). Its art design calls to mind older arcade racing games such as Super Sprint and Slicks N Slide. PCGamer, in an issue about free PC games, described it as A minimalist Micro Machines. Formula One 2000 is a racing game in the Formula One series of video games. It is also the only game of the series, known to be made on a nonSony console (Game Boy Color) . Drivers appearing on the front cover are Mika H kkinen (McLaren) and Jarno Trulli (Jordan). Formula One 2000 contained the new arcade mode, which had been missing from its predecessor, Formula One 99. This arcade mode seemed more similar in style to WipEouttracks were grouped into location zones with futuristicsounding names and cars were grouped into series. The player began on the easier courses with the worst cars, before unlocking the more difficult courses and the better cars. Bonus images could be unlocked as an incentive to win races. An audio game is an electronic game played on a device such as a personal computer. It is similar to a video game save that the only feedback device is audible rather than visual. Audio games originally started out as blind accessiblegames and were developed mostly by amateurs and blind programmers citation needed]. But more and more people are showing interest in audio games, ranging from sound artists, game accessibility researchers, mobile game developers and mainstream video gamers. Most audio games run on a personal computer platform, although there are a few audio games for handhelds and video game consoles. An online textbased role playing game is a roleplaying game played online using a solely textbased interface. Online textbased role playing games date to 1978, with the creation of MUD1, which began the MUD heritage that culminates in todays MMORPGs. Some onlinetext based role playing games are video games, but some are organized and played entirely by humans through textbased communication. Over the years, games have used TELNET, internet forums, IRC, email and social networking websites as their medium. There are varied genres of online textbased roleplaying, including medieval fantasy, period drama (e.g., 19th century, 1950s), modern horror, anime, and mediabased fan roleplay. Roleplaying games based on popular media (for example, the Harry Potter series) are common, and the players involved tend to overlap with the relevant fandoms. Racing Video Game $60.54 High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les A racing video game is a genre of video games, either in the first or thirdperson perspective, in which the player partakes in a racing competition with any type of land, air, or sea vehicles. They may be based on anything from realworld racing leagues to entirely fantastical settings. In general, they can be distributed along a spectrum anywhere between hardcore simulations, and simpler arcade racing games. The arcade game Gran Trak 10, released by Atari in 1974, is generally considered the progenitor of the genre. Gran Trak 10 presents an overhead view of the track in low resolution white on black graphics, on which the player races against the clock to accumulate points. While challenging, it is not competition racing. Night Racer, released by Micronetics in 1977, extended the genre into three dimensions by presenting a series of posts by the edge of the road. There was no view of the road or the players car and the graphics are still low resolution white on black. Like Gran Trak 10, gameplay was a race against the clock. Gran Turismo was developed by Polyphony Digital and first published by Sony Computer Entertainment in 1997 for the PlayStation video game console. The game was originally only sold in Japan but the popularity of the game led to an American version and then a European version being sold in other countries. After five years of development time, it was wellreceived publicly and critically, shipping a total of 10.85 million copies worldwide as of April 30, 2008, and scoring an average of 95 in GameRankings aggregate. The game has started a series, and to date has spawned over 10 spinoffs and sequels. Gran Turismo is fundamentally based on the racing simulator genre. The player must maneuver an automobile to compete against artificially intelligent drivers on various race tracks. The game uses two different modes: arcade and simulation. In the arcade mode, the player can freely choose the courses and vehicles they wish to use. Winning races unlocks additional cars and courses. Vehicle Title $71.7 High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les When a vehicle is financed, the certificate of title is normally held by the lender, who must release it to the purchaser once the balance is paid off. In some states, the transferred title is sent directly to that individual, but the name of the lender or lienholder appears on the title as well. In order to release the lien upon full payment, the lender sends a notarized release or other complementary document to the individual. When a car is sold from one owner to another, the title must be transferred to the new owner. This is achieved by requesting approval by the state DMV. The pink slip reference is based on California state vehicle titles that were printed on pink paper. It was referenced in the 1978 film Grease and also on the Speed Channel racing series Pinks, in the Beach Boys song Little Deuce Coupe, and on the game show The Price Is Rights pricing game Gas Money, where a contestant is to avoid the pink slip to win the game. The Fast and The Furiousis a racing game for the PlayStation 2 and PlayStation Portable. The game is based on the film series of the same name; particularly, The Fast and the Furious: Tokyo Drift. It should not be confused with The Fast and the Furious arcade game, which was later ported to the Nintendo Wii as Cruisn (due to the publisher losing the license rights).This game features many different races that may take place on the Wangan, or on the local mountain roads called Touge. There are two types of races that can take place on the Wangan: Destination Races a simple point to point race, and Top Speed Battles whoever can set the highest speed record in between the start and finish wins. The Touge also features two events: Grip Battles point to point race going uphill or downhill through tight Hairpin Turns, and Drift Battles whoever can accumulate the most points by the end of the run wins. Tower of Babel is a video game developed and published by Namco on August 18, 1986 only in Japan. It is a platformer/puzzle hybrid that was first released for the Family Computer. Later, Nintendo adapted the title for play in the arcade as part of their Nintendo Vs. Series, calling it Vs. Tower of Babel. An enhanced version of it was later ported to the Sharp X68000. In 1997, the game was included on a compilation made for the Game Boy known as Namco Gallery Vol. 3. In 1998, the game was also included on a compilation made for the PlayStation known as Namco Anthology 1 where, like all of the Famicom games presented on the disc, an enhanced arrange mode was provided alongside the unaltered original game.
